Is Chick-fil-A Gluten-Free?
While Chick-fil-A isn't a dedicated gluten-free fast food restaurant, it does offer several gluten-free menu items for those with celiac disease. It pairs this with dedicated gluten-free fryers so you can safely enjoy their coveted waffle fries, among many other delicious dishes.

Chick-fil-A Gluten-Free Menu
Chick-fil-A has a comprehensive list of its gluten-free menu items on the official website. The company is very transparent about its menu and which items are safe to consume on a gluten-free diet.
That said, because they aren't prepared in a completely gluten-free environment, they can't definitively confirm that any of the items below are completely free of gluten.
Chick-fil-A always recommends checking the ingredients in the Nutrition Guide available in every restaurant or on the Chick-fil-A website to double-check for food allergies.
You also shouldn't hesitate to tell staff about your gluten allergy, as the cashier will add this to your ticket and notify staff of your gluten intolerance. Staff will then change gloves and clean surfaces before preparing your meal.

Gluten-Free Buns
If you're a frequent visitor to Chick-fil-A, you'll know it offers a gluten-free bun. Now, the naturally gluten-free bun is sealed before entering the restaurant to avoid cross-contamination with other gluten-containing ingredients in the kitchen. It's also served to you still in the packaging.
However, Chick-fil-A warns that once customers remove the bun from the packaging, it can no longer be considered gluten-free because of the increase in close contact with gluten-containing ingredients.
Therefore, it's up to the individual whether they try a gluten-free bun. If you have a severe gluten allergy, Chick-fil-A is one of several fast food restaurants where you can sub gluten-free bun or no bun at all.
The gluten-free bun is made with ancient grains like quinoa and amaranth, which are lightly sweetened with molasses and raisins. We think you'll find it's one of the tastiest GF buns available at fast-food restaurants today.
Gluten-Free Sandwiches (With a Gluten-Free Bun)
While you can't have the iconic Original Chicken Sandwich, Chick-fil-A offers a grilled chicken sandwich. You'll just need to substitute the regular bun for a gluten-free bun or no bun. The Chick-fil-A Grilled Chicken Sandwich includes a marinated grilled chicken breast with lettuce and tomato. We recommend pairing it with Honey Mustard Sauce.
For an elevated grilled chicken sandwich, try the Grilled Chicken Club Sandwich with a gluten-free bun. The lemon-herb marinated chicken breast is paired with the cheese of your choice, smoked bacon, lettuce, and tomato. Enjoy it with Honey Roasted BBQ Sauce.
Gluten-Free Salads
Chick-fil-A offers three salads, and they're all gluten-free.
Market Salad With Grilled Nuggets, Grilled Filet, or No Chicken
The grilled market salad includes mixed greens topped with crumbled blue cheese, apples, strawberries, and blueberries. It's served with Harvest Nut Granola and Roasted Almonds. Its recommended dressing is the gluten-free Zesty Apple Cider Vinaigrette.
While the granola doesn't include gluten-containing ingredients, it isn't made with gluten-free oats, so we can't confirm how safe it is for those with gluten intolerance.
Cobb Salad With Grilled Nuggets, Grilled Filet, or No Chicken
This salad includes mixed greens, roasted corn kernels, Monterey Jack and cheddar cheese, crumbled bacon, sliced hard-boiled egg, and grape tomatoes. Chick-fil-A recommends pairing it with Avocado Lime Ranch Dressing.
Crispy Bell Peppers are an optional extra, but these are not gluten-free.
Spicy Southwest Salad With Grilled Nuggets, Grilled Chicken Filet, or No Chicken
A fan favorite, this includes mixed greens, grape tomatoes, Monterey Jack and cheddar cheese, roasted corn kernels, black beans, poblano chiles, and red bell peppers. It's served with Seasoned Tortilla Strips and Chilli Lime Pepitas, which are both gluten-free and pre-packaged.
Chick-fil-A recommends enjoying it with Creamy Salsa Dressing.

Gluten-Free Sides
Let's first discuss the most iconic and popular Chick-fil-A side dish: Waffle Potato Fries. Thankfully, this is a gluten-free food option as they're naturally gluten-free and deep-fried in a dedicated fryer in peanut oil. It's important to confirm with your local Chick-fil-A restaurant whether they have a separate fryer though. If they do, you're good to go!
Here are the other gluten-free sides available at Chick-fil-A:
- Fruit Cup
- Greek Yogurt Parfait: The topping options are Harvest Nut Granola and Cookie Crumbs. As mentioned, we cannot confirm whether the granola is 100% gluten-free, but we know for a fact the cookies contain wheat.
- Waffle Potato Chips: Like the gluten-free buns, Chick-fil-A's waffle chips are sealed before entering the restaurant to limit cross-contamination.
- Kale Crunch Side (kale, green cabbage, and crunchy almonds).
- Side Salad (cherry tomatoes, mixed greens, and cheese).

Gluten-Free Chick-fil-A Breakfast Items
Gluten-free consumers can enjoy the bacon slice, sausage patty, and hash browns available on the Chick-fil-A breakfast menu.
The Hash Brown Scramble Bowls with Grilled Filet or Sausage are also gluten-free.
Remember to just confirm with your local restaurant if they have a dedicated gluten-free fryer for their hash browns.
Another option is to get a breakfast sandwich on a gluten-free bun. This includes either bacon or sausage with egg and cheese – all naturally gluten-free ingredients. But remember they're prepared in a shared facility.

Gluten-Free Desserts
Don't worry, you can finish your meal with a Buddy Fruits Apple Sauce or a creamy Icedream Cup, as they're both gluten-free menu items. If you're unfamiliar, Icedream is simply a cup of vanilla soft-serve ice cream.
There are no gluten-free cones at Chick-fil-A, so stick to the cup.
Gluten-Free Drinks
Chick-fil-A considers all their drinks to be gluten-free. This includes their bottled drinks, chocolate, strawberry, and vanilla milkshakes, iced teas, and Frosted Coffee or Lemonade drinks.

Non-Gluten-Free Items to Avoid at Chick-fil-A
The Chick-fil-A menu is extensive, but here are the items those who avoid gluten want to steer clear of:
- Any breakfast item that includes a biscuit or muffin. Instead, swap these for gluten-free buns or no buns.
- Breaded Chicken Nuggets
- Caramel Crumble and Cookies & Cream Milkshakes
- Chicken Noodle Soup
- Chicken Tortilla Soup
- Chick-n-Strips
- Chocolate Chunk Cookie
- Chocolate Fudge Brownie
- Cool Wrap (the ingredients are gluten-free, but the wrap isn't).
- Icedream Cone
- Mac & Cheese
- Original, Deluxe, and Spicy Chicken Sandwiches (sorry). Basically, any sandwich with fried chicken is a no-go.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is Chick-fil-A Safe For Celiacs?
Chick-fil-A cannot 100% confirm that its fast food restaurants are safe for people with celiac disease, as there is always the chance of cross-contamination. However, Chick-fil-A offers naturally gluten-free food options and has food allergy guidelines in place.
Is The Hashbrown Bowl At Chick-fil-A Gluten-Free?
Yes, the Hash Brown Scramble Bowl with either a grilled chicken breast or sausage patty is considered gluten-free.
Are Chick-fil-A Hash Browns Gluten-Free?
Yes, the hash browns are gluten-free and fried in a dedicated fryer.
Are the Fries at Chick-fil-A Gluten-Free?
Yes, Chick-fil-A waffle fries are gluten-free and fried in a separate fryer.
Is Bottled Chick-fil-A Sauce Gluten-Free?
Yes, the original Chick-fil-A Sauce is gluten-free, whether you buy a bottle or enjoy it at the restaurant.
Are Chick-fil-A Nuggets Gluten-Free?
Chick-fil-A Grilled Nuggets are gluten-free. Ordinary fried nuggets are not.
Are Chick-fil-A Milkshakes Gluten-Free?
Yes, the strawberry, vanilla, and chocolate milkshakes at Chick-fil-A are all gluten-free. You want to avoid the Caramel Crumble and Cookies & Cream Milkshakes.
Is Chick-fil-A Polynesian Sauce Gluten-Free?
Yes, Polynesian Sauce (among many others) is gluten-free.
